- AkshitFeb 07, 2026 · 2 months agoTo find historical price data for Blockstacks, you can also consider using cryptocurrency APIs such as CoinAPI, Nomics, or CryptoCompare. These APIs provide access to historical price data for various cryptocurrencies, including Blockstacks. You can integrate these APIs into your own applications or use them to perform in-depth analysis and create custom charts.
- Mahamadou SackoMay 06, 2023 · 3 years agoHistorical price data for Blockstacks can also be found on popular cryptocurrency exchanges such as Binance, Coinbase, and Kraken. These exchanges offer historical price charts and data for a wide range of cryptocurrencies, including Blockstacks. You can access the historical price data by visiting the respective exchange's website or using their trading platforms. Keep in mind that different exchanges may have slightly different data due to variations in trading volume and liquidity.
